Transaction 3ec10465494100564acd3b222f7d11437d2d5c29a39af0b62f7beb1493b560e6
1 Input
1 Output
-
3ec10465494100564acd3b222f7d11437d2d5c29a39af0b62f7beb1493b560e6:0
- value
- 88705
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95ea4cc64127ccdcf8cce4d4e7621c20825e29c1 OP_EQUAL
- address
- 3FMhHZxBbuWcCYp2Xdf6vufb6258CHGgvg